The Hexadecimal Color #E588D5 is a contrast shade of Orchid. #E588D5 RGB value is rgb(229, 136, 213). RGB Color Model of #E588D5 consists of 89% red, 53% green and 83% blue. HSL color Mode of #E588D5 has 310°(degrees) Hue, 64% Saturation and 72% Lightness. #E588D5 color has an wavelength of 424.81481n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#E588D5 is #FF99FF.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#E588D5 is #D8D. The Closest Color to #E588D5 is #DA70D6. Official Name of #E588D5 Hex Code is Light Orchid.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#E588D5 is 0 Cyan 41 Magenta 7 Yellow 10 Black and #E588D5 CMY is 0, 41, 7.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#E588D5

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
